Dehradun, Dec. 29 -- A day after breaking his silence over the racial killing of 24-year-old MBA student from Tripura in Dehradun, Uttarakhand Chief Minister Pushkar Singh Dhami promised deceased 's father that culprits will be dealt with a heavy hand.
Dhami called victim's father Tarun Prasad Chakma, a BSF Jawan, on mobile phone on Monday and expressed his grief over the racial killing of his son Anjel Chakma, saying his government will lend all possible help to the family.
The Chief Minister informed Prasad that five accused have already been arrested in the case and a sixth is suspected to have fled to Nepal. The CM told Prasad that his government has announced a reward on the absconder and efforts are underway to arrest him.
